Seamless Creation: How a Single AI Platform Works
Users start by providing the AI with raw content, such as a text prompt, an outline, a pasted document, or a meeting transcript. The AI platform organizes this input and creates a foundational layout that you can adapt into different formats. Instead of treating slides, pages, and documents as completely separate items, the system sees them as different ways to show the same core information.
Instead of starting over in a new application, you can toggle the output format directly within the workspace. You can instantly reformat a pitch deck into a scrolling website or a formatted document. This means marketing teams can generate campaign decks and supporting web pages from the exact same content brief, maintaining alignment between different formats effortlessly.
The AI handles visual tasks automatically. It automatically resizes images, adjusts typography, aligns layouts, and applies color palettes based on predetermined rules. This lets you focus strictly on refining your narrative rather than manually formatting text boxes or aligning shapes on a grid.
When you need edits, the AI acts as an intelligent design partner, handling revisions. You can interact with the AI to change layouts, rewrite sections, or apply new visual themes across the entire project in seconds. The system keeps your content cohesive and visually appealing, whether you're viewing it as a presented slide, a printed document, or a live webpage.

Understanding Limitations: When Specialized Tools Remain Essential
While AI handles most business design needs, you might still need specialized legacy tools for certain highly technical tasks. Teams requiring highly complex, custom vector graphics, intricate animations, or professional video editing will likely still need dedicated design software to accomplish those specific tasks.
Some enterprise workflows demand offline editing capabilities or heavy spreadsheet-style slide builds, where legacy tools like a dedicated presentation app still excel. A unified AI platform works best for quickly generating complete drafts and maintaining brand compliance. It's not for pixel-perfect manual manipulation of complex data tables without an internet connection.
Ensure the chosen unified AI platform supports native export formats. Because stakeholders often still use traditional systems, ensure you can export AI-generated content into standard files, like a native PowerPoint presentation or a PDF document. This is essential for external collaboration and archiving.
